Wizz Air, the fastest growing airline in Europe and the most environmentally sustainable in the world*, has announced the launch of a new flight route: Sofia to Heraklion. Flights from the bustling capital of Bulgaria to the cultural treasure of the island of Crete will start in June, and tickets are already on sale at wizzair.com and in the mobile application, at prices of only BGN 59.

Starting on June 24, when WIZZ's first Sofia-Heraklion flight of 2024 will take place, passengers will be able to embark on an unforgettable Greek journey to explore the fascinating sights, rich history and culture that await them in Heraklion. Bulgarian tourists will be able to take advantage of direct flights twice a week, every Monday and Friday.
